The Business Problem: Project-Based Revenue Instability
Traditional ERP reselling relies on one-off implementation fees. This model creates revenue volatility, as income spikes during projects and drops during maintenance periods. For manufacturing enterprises, ERP implementations are complex, involving intricate supply chain, production, and inventory processes. Without standardization, each project becomes a unique challenge, leading to inconsistent quality, higher costs, and increased risk. Resellers struggle to predict cash flow and scale operations. The business problem is not just technical; it is structural. Resellers must transform their operating model to capture the long-term value of the ERP system through ongoing services.
Strategic Shift to Recurring Revenue Models
Recurring revenue in the ERP ecosystem is driven by managed services, support, optimization, and continuous improvement. To achieve this, resellers must standardize the implementation lifecycle. Standardization reduces the time and cost of each project, allowing resellers to deliver more value with fewer resources. It also creates a foundation for managed services, as standardized processes are easier to monitor, support, and optimize. The shift requires a change in mindset from 'selling software' to 'managing business outcomes.' Resellers must position themselves as strategic partners who ensure the ERP system delivers continuous value, not just a one-time installation.
Components of Recurring Revenue
- Managed Support: Ongoing technical support, issue resolution, and system monitoring.
- Optimization Services: Regular reviews to improve system performance and business process efficiency.
- Change Management: Managing updates, new modules, and process changes.
- Training and Enablement: Continuous user training and knowledge transfer.
- Integration Management: Maintaining and optimizing integrations with other systems.
Implementation Standardization Framework
Implementation standardization is the backbone of scalable ERP delivery. It involves creating reusable templates, methodologies, and tools for each phase of the implementation lifecycle. This includes discovery, requirements gathering, process design, configuration, data migration, testing, training, and go-live. Standardization ensures consistency across projects, reduces errors, and accelerates delivery. It also facilitates knowledge transfer, as new team members can quickly understand the process. For manufacturing ERP, standardization must account for industry-specific processes, such as bill of materials management, production scheduling, and quality control. A standardized framework allows resellers to predict project timelines and costs more accurately, reducing risk and improving customer satisfaction.
Key Phases of Standardization
- Discovery and Requirements: Standardized questionnaires and process mapping templates.
- Solution Design: Reusable architecture patterns and configuration guides.
- Data Migration: Standardized data cleansing and mapping tools.
- Testing: Automated test scripts and user acceptance testing (UAT) frameworks.
- Go-Live: Standardized cutover plans and support protocols.
Partner Operating Models and Responsibilities
Resellers can choose from several operating models: customer-led, partner-led, vendor-led, co-delivery, or managed services. Each model has different implications for control, speed, expertise, and accountability. In a co-delivery model, the reseller and a specialized implementation partner share responsibilities. The reseller typically owns the customer relationship, governance, and overall project success, while the partner handles technical execution. This model balances control with expertise. In a managed services model, the reseller or a dedicated MSP takes ownership of the system post-go-live, providing ongoing support and optimization. The choice of model depends on the reseller's internal capabilities, the complexity of the implementation, and the customer's requirements.
| Model | Control | Speed | Expertise | Accountability | Scalability |
|---|---|---|---|---|---|
| Customer-Led | High | Low | Variable | Customer | Low |
| Partner-Led | Low | High | High | Partner | High |
| Vendor-Led | Medium | Medium | High | Vendor | Medium |
| Co-Delivery | Medium | Medium | High | Shared | High |
| Managed Services | High | Medium | High | Reseller/MSP | High |
Governance and Accountability Structures
Effective governance is critical for managing partner ecosystems and ensuring accountability. A governance structure should include a steering committee with representatives from the customer, reseller, and key partners. This committee oversees project progress, resolves conflicts, and makes strategic decisions. Roles and responsibilities must be clearly defined using a RACI matrix (Responsible, Accountable, Consulted, Informed). The reseller is typically accountable for overall project success, while partners are responsible for specific deliverables. Escalation paths must be established to address issues quickly. Change control processes must be in place to manage scope changes and ensure they are approved and documented. Risk registers should be maintained to identify and mitigate potential issues. Clear governance reduces ambiguity, improves communication, and ensures that all parties are aligned on goals and expectations.
Technology Architecture and Integration
Manufacturing ERP systems must integrate with other enterprise systems, such as CRM, supply chain, warehouse management, and e-commerce. Integration architecture should be designed to be scalable, secure, and maintainable. APIs, middleware, and event-driven architectures are common approaches. Data ownership and system of record must be clearly defined to avoid conflicts. Integration boundaries should be well-defined, with clear protocols for authentication, authorization, error handling, and monitoring. Standardized integration patterns reduce complexity and improve reliability. Resellers must ensure that their partners have the expertise to design and implement these integrations. Poor integration can lead to data inconsistencies, operational disruptions, and increased support costs. A robust integration strategy is essential for the long-term success of the ERP system.
Risk Management and Mitigation
ERP implementations carry significant risks, including scope creep, data quality issues, integration failures, and post-go-live support gaps. Resellers must implement risk management practices to mitigate these risks. This includes thorough requirements gathering, rigorous testing, and clear change control processes. Partner dependency is a key risk; resellers must ensure that knowledge is transferred and documented to avoid lock-in. Security risks must be addressed through identity and access management, encryption, and audit trails. Resellers should conduct regular risk assessments and update risk registers throughout the project. Proactive risk management reduces the likelihood of project failure and improves customer trust. It also supports the transition to managed services, as a well-managed implementation is easier to support and optimize.
